MANUU is Conducting Written Test for Non-Teaching Posts

Hyderabad: Maulana Azad National Urdu University is conducting written tests for various Non-Teaching Posts notified vide employment notification No. 63/2022 from August 19 to 22, 2023 at its Gachibowli Campus.

According to the Registrar, written tests for the posts of Lower Division Clerk, Section Officer, Maintenance Assistant will be held on August 19 and for the posts of Lab Attendant, Sr. Research Assistant test will be conducted on August 20. On August 21 the written test will be held for Assistant Registrar, Pharmacist, Semi Professional Assistant, Electrician, Library Attendant and Lab Assistant whereas for the post of Instructor-Polytechnic (Computer Science Engineering, Civil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Electrical & Electronics Engineering), Stenographer and Workshop Assistant the test will be conducted on August 22.

Applicants for the posts of Lower Division Clerk, Section Officer and Assistant Registrar will have to write test for Paper I and Paper II separately on the same day in forenoon and afternoon sessions whereas for the post of Assistant, the test for Paper I and Paper II will be conducted on August 19 and 20  in the forenoon session.

The candidates who have applied for above-mentioned posts vide employment notification No. 63/2022 can visit university website www.mannu.edu.in for further details.

Hall Tickets have been dispatched to the eligible candidates.
